Rootkits are malicious software that allows an unauthorized user to access a computer and restricted areas of software. Rootkits are difficult to detect on your computer because it may be able to subvert there that is intended to find it. Rootkits are created by Black-hat hackers to attack your computer and steal.
Rootkit tools:
1. Keyloggers
2. antivirus disablers
3. password stealers
4. banking credential stealers
5. bots for DDoS attacks
